Output e58ed3dd25abccd355ead007624eb82ec2858876999ee4e67c138fdbb37010dd:0

value
537248
script pubkey
OP_0 OP_PUSHBYTES_20 dbcda244882b08a233fcfce6f951d32a996566a7
address
bc1qm0x6y3yg9vy2yvlulnn0j5wn92vk2e489af3u6
transaction
e58ed3dd25abccd355ead007624eb82ec2858876999ee4e67c138fdbb37010dd
confirmations
4542
spent
true